    It was time to upgrade our old Wi-Fi wireless router!
    My search for a reasonably priced, vertical standing Wi-Fi unit, with the latest wireless security, found Netgear. Since I don't need the very best, as this is only used for Wi-Fi - wireless devices, the Netgear N750 looked promising! We have a D-link DGL-4100 hardwired gigabit LAN for our main devices.The pros:+ Reasonable priced, brand new, at $45 with free Amazon shipping when I bought this.+ Lots of customer product reviews & answered questions.+ The Netgear genie does a pretty good job setting up the system. It detected our existing D-Link DGL-4100 router & suggested setting the Netgear N750 as a wireless AP - access point.+ The 5 GHz Wi-Fi - wireless is much faster than the 2.4 GHz wireless on our old Wi-Fi router!+ The 2.4 GHz Wi-Fi - wireless can be turned off, to save power, if you don't need it.+ Advertised - Wi-Fi speed 300 + 450 - up to 750Mbps+ Advertised - Wi-Fi range for medium to large homes+ Advertised - 1 CPU, DDR3 SDRAM: 128 MB, flash memory size =128 MB.+ Advertised - wireless type: 802.11 a/b/g/n+ Advertised - secure Wi-Fi connections - WPA/WPA2.+ Advertised - wirelessly access and share USB Hard Drive and Printer+ Advertised - simultaneous dual band 2.4GHz & 5GHz.+ Advertised - broadband (cable, DSL) Internet service and modem with Ethernet connection.+ Advertised - multiple HD video streaming, multiplayer gaming, secure and reliable connection to the Internet.+ Advertised - double firewall protection (SPI and NAT firewall).+ Advertised - item Dimensions: L x W x H, 5.86 x 2.99 x 9.21 inches.+ Advertised - weight: 15.8 ounces.+ comes with a 5 foot Ethernet cable, 12 VDC, 1.5 A switching power supply & basic written setup instructions. The complete user manual can be downloaded in PDF format. ◄ The Ethernet cable was too short for our application.The cons:+ Advertised - color = black. ◄ Shiny black that will get covered with fingerprints & will scratch easily!- Made in China. ◄ For those that prefer to buy products made in the USA.- Support limited to 90 days from the date of purchase. you have to register to get this 90 day support.- When positioned vertically, this is recommended for the best Wi-Fi - wireless coverage, it can only sit one way. One side (left) is the top & it looks nice. The other side (right) is the bottom & it's butt ugly!- No Wi-Fi activity LED. ◄ What's up with this? How can you tell if there's Wi-Fi - wireless activity?- If the N750 is set as a Wi-Fi wireless AP - access point, the "internet" LED will never change to green, it will stay amber (yellow). ◄ Another annoyance, as this "normally" indicates you don't have a connection to the internet!- In normal operation, our N750 has 4 lit LED. None of the LED "blink" to indicate "activity", they are just lit. It would be nice, especially with the Wi-Fi, if that LED would "blink" to show Wi-Fi activity! ◄ Yes, another curious design flaw!Closing remarks:▪ Netgear support was not very helpful & are slow to respond. VERY annoying, poor technical support, in my opinion!▪ Came with firmware v1.0.2.80, updated to v1.0.2.104.▪ When the N750 is set as a wireless AP - access point, all the hardwired devices on our existing LAN are visible & accessible.▪ If the wireless AP - access point is not enabled, ONLY the hardwired devices connected to the N750 will be visible & accessible. Anything connected to an existing router will not be visible or accessible!Pictures:▪ The first picture shows N750 set as a wireless AP - access point. Note the amber (yellow) internet LED! This is how our N750 is setup & it is working perfectly. The amber (yellow) LED would seem to tell you the internet is not connected, but that's NOT the case!▪ The second picture shows the N750 with the wireless AP - access point disabled. Note that that the internet LED is green! This is the router + WiFi -wireless setup.
